Ajouter un commentaire pour les entités et chaque propriété
Bug #712450 reported by
kimaidou
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
AnalyseSI |
New
|
Undecided
|
Unassigned |
Bug Description
Il serait intéressant de pouvoir documenter un peu le MCD.
Je verrais bien un ajout de commentaire textuelle
* pour les entités
* au moment de la création d'une nouvelle propriété (vide par défaut).
Les commentaires seront ensuite utilisés pour générer des commandes SQL du type
Pour PostGresql
COMMENT ON TABLE personne IS 'qsdqsdqsd';
COMMENT ON COLUMN personne.couleur IS 'sdfsdfsdfdsf';
Pour MySQL:
CREATE TABLE boo (
id BIGINT UNSIGNED NOT NULL AUTO_INCREMENT COMMENT 'The KEY obviously',
mycol VARCHAR COMMENT 'ma colonne favorite'
) ENGINE=InnoDB COMMENT='this is the table comment'
To post a comment you must log in.
Une idée liée : on pourrait afficher une sorte d'info bulle :
* au survol d'une entité : on voit le commentaire sur l'entité dans l'info bulle
* au survol d'une ligne du dictionnaire de donnée : on voit le commentaire lié
Se pose par contre la question de la modification de commentaires déjà entrés.
* pour les propriétés : Soit un bouton pour chaque ligne du dictionnaire de données, qui ouvre une fenêtre d'édition du texte. Soit une colonne en plus, mais c'est moins évident car les commentaires peuvent être longs et le tableau du dictionnaire de données doit rester compact et lisible.
* pour les entités : ajout d'un bouton dans l'ui qui est appelée sur double clic d'une entité "commenter", et qui ouvre aussi une pop-up